Maybe you can return the other unopened cans. They are all too high in carbs for a diabetic cat. You could always try something like all meat baby food. Beechnut and Gerbers make them. Cats usually like them and they are OK for a few meals, though not complete so not good for long term.
Too bad they gave you Mirtazapine. Mirataz is the same drug in ointment form that you rub in their ears. It's much easier to give and less likely to have side effects. It's an appetite stimulant. Make sure you give it at a separate time from the Cerenia. You don't want to give an appetite stimulant to a nauseous cat.
